      <title>FFTP: Is there an 'International Freedom' equivalent?</title>
      <link>https://community.bt.com/t5/Bills-Packages/FFTP-Is-there-an-International-Freedom-equivalent/m-p/2276146#M151665</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;I'd like to upgrade from Fibre1 (69Mb) to a Full-Fibre-to-Property (100Mb+) but am in a bit of a quandry.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Currently, we have a Paygo landline with the '&lt;STRONG&gt;International Freedom&lt;/STRONG&gt;' addon - because the only calls we make is once a week to our family in &lt;EM&gt;New Zealand&lt;/EM&gt;.&lt;BR /&gt;I can't see any similar International Calls addon if I was to upgrade to FFTP and I don't see our calls to NZ being Free of Charge through FFTP (if only), so does that mean we'd also have to retain a Landline to get the same benefit we do now? Seems like a costly move if so!&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.bt.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/311893"&gt;@Cholmondeley&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;Welcome to the community and thanks for posting. The International Freedom calling plan add-on is available on digital voice, the plans we offer are the same on both analogue and digital voice lines.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;When choosing your package make sure to select broadband &amp;amp; phone and it will give you the options to choose your calling plan and add-ons.&lt;/P&gt;
